essential hotel supplies for smoother daily service
Running a hotel requires careful preparation, stable inventory, and reliable products for every department. From guest rooms to bathrooms and housekeeping areas, hotel supplies help hotels maintain comfort, cleanliness, efficiency, and a professional guest experience.
Hotel supplies may include bedding, towels, toiletries, slippers, bathroom amenities, cleaning tools, detergents, laundry products, trash bags, room accessories, restaurant items, lobby products, and storage supplies. Each product may seem simple, but together they shape how guests experience the property during their stay.
Quality is one of the most important factors when choosing supplies. Bed sheets should feel clean and comfortable, towels should be soft and absorbent, and toiletries should be safe and pleasant to use. Cleaning products should help staff maintain hygiene without damaging surfaces. Poor-quality supplies can lead to guest complaints, faster replacement, and higher long-term costs.
Consistency also matters. Hotels should keep room products, bathroom items, and public-area supplies uniform across the property. Matching styles, packaging, and materials make rooms look more organized and professional. This helps strengthen the hotel’s brand image and improves the overall guest impression.
Inventory planning is another key part of hotel management. Hotels should track how quickly supplies are used and reorder before stock becomes low. Running out of towels, soap, cleaning products, or guest amenities can delay room preparation and reduce service quality.
Supplier reliability should also be considered. A dependable supplier should provide clear product information, stable stock, reasonable pricing, and timely delivery. This helps managers save time and avoid unnecessary purchasing problems.
Overall, suitable hotel supplies support better guest comfort, smoother housekeeping, and stronger daily operations. Careful sourcing helps hotels maintain service standards while controlling costs and building a more reliable hospitality experience.
